Post Full Size Photos on Instagram without Cropping
The photos caught with the Instagram are restricted to skip square format, so for the objective of this pointer, you will certainly have to use an additional Camera application to catch your pictures. As soon as done, open the Instagram application as well as surf your photo gallery for the wanted image (Camera icon > Gallery).
Touch on small button displayed near the bottom left edge of the photo to change from the default square photo format to a full size image as well as vice versa:
Edit the image to your taste (apply the wanted filters as well as results ...) and also upload it.
N.B. This pointer applies to iphone and Android.
How To Put Excellent Quality Photos To Instagram
You do not need to export complete resolution to make your images look fantastic - they most likely look excellent when you view them from the back of your DSLR, and also they are little there! You simply need to increase top quality within exactly what you need to collaborate with.
Couple of points to think about:
What format are you moving? If its not sRGB JPEG you are probably damaging shade information, and that is your first potential issue. Make sure your Camera is using sRGB as well as you are exporting JPEG from your Camera (or PNG, yet thats rarer as an outcome alternative).
The problem may be (a minimum of partially) color equilibrium. Your DSLR will normally make several pictures as well blue on car white balance if you are north of the equator as an example, so you may intend to make your shade balance warmer.
The other large problem is that you are moving huge, crisp photos, and when you move them to your iPhone, it resizes (or adjustments file-size), and also the file is almost certainly resized once again on upload. This can create a sloppy mess of a photo.
For * highest *, you should Put complete resolution pictures from your DSLR to an application that comprehends the complete data style of your Camera and also from the application export to jpeg as well as Upload them to your social media sites website at a known size that works finest for the target site, seeing to it that the website doesn't over-compress the picture, creating loss of top quality.
As in instance work-flow to Post to facebook, I pack raw information documents from my DSLR to Adobe Lightroom (runs on on a desktop), and from there, modify as well as resize down to a jpeg documents with lengthiest side of 2048 pixels or 960 pixels, making certain to add a bit of grain on the original photo to stop Facebook compressing the picture as well far and also triggering color banding. If I do all this, my uploaded photos (exported out from DSLR > LR > FB) always look excellent despite the fact that they are a lot smaller file-size.
